When I launch the HDHR app on my Roku, I get a message saying that I need to update the DVR software and then the app closes. I never get into the app and can't watch TV. Is this related to these recent release issues?

Hardware Model HDHR5-4US
Firmware Version 20231214
Device ID 10780ED1

Roku Express 4K Pro

The error message is correct - you have a old DVR record engine installed on your Mac that hasn't been updated for 5 years.

Option 1 is to install the latest HDHomeRun software on your Mac including the DVR feature.

Option 2 is to uninstall the DVR record engine from your Mac if you are not using it:
https://info.hdhomerun.com/info/dvr:mac ... installing

Also the clock on your Mac is off by 1m56s. It won't affect recording but it might affect other apps.

Thanks for the reply. What I don’t understand is why the version of software on my Mac is impacting my ability to use the HDHR app on my Roku?

I’ve updated (downloaded the latest) HDHR on my Mac, but I still have the same error on the Roku.

The HDHR app works fine on my iPhone and on my Nividia Shield devices, but just not on the Roku.

The DVR record engine running on your Mac is too old for the Roku app to be able to use it. In theory we could make the app ignore the out-of-date record engine but that would confuse people who expect to see their recordings on Roku.

Quick test - turn off your Mac and then launch the Roku app - make sure it works with the Mac off.

My guess is that you updated the HDHomeRun (player) app on Mac but not the record engine.

To update the record engine you need to use the installer from our Download page (not from the app store) AND you need to tick the option for installing the record engine (not ticked by default).

It looks like you are not using the record engine so probably best to uninstall it:
https://info.hdhomerun.com/info/dvr:mac ... installing

Thanks for your help. I did the test with my Mac turned off and you were right, the Roku worked fine. I then updated the software on the Mac via the HDHR website and checked the box to upgrade the recording software and then after tried the Roku again with the Mac on and it works fine now. Appreciate all the help. I had no idea that the software on my Mac could impact my other devices. Cheers!!
